新AI系统和基准测试提高了气象预报的准确性

研究人员开发了AFDBench,这是一个新的基准测试和AI系统,旨在提高气象预报讨论的准确性和专业语气。该系统解决了大型语言模型在高风险天气通信中虚构数值数据的问题。AFDBench利用Google的WeatherNext 2的结构化AI天气预报数据,并采用强化学习技术来训练模型,使其能够遵循国家气象局的专业注册规范并准确解释天气数据。 AI

影响 这项研究可能带来更可靠、更专业的AI生成天气预报,从而提高公众安全和沟通效率。
